Client Trainer II (Fixed Ops)

Remote · USA Full-time New today

Are you passionate about helping others succeed — and finding success in your own career? Join Cox Automotive as a Client Trainer II and play a key part in transforming how our dealer clients do business. In this role, you’ll deliver impactful training that helps clients get the most out of our technology, all while building your own project management, technical and leadership skills. This position requires nationwide, weekly overnight travel four days per week with one remote workday. What’s in It for You? Check out all our benefits. What You’ll Do You’ll work with dealership leaders to design and deliver training sessions tailored to their operations and goals. Whether you’re leading in-person or virtual sessions, your focus will be on helping clients adopt new technologies confidently and effectively. Here’s a snapshot of how you’ll make an impact:

  • Complete training and certification in the Fixed Ops (Parts/Service) domain to deliver expert instruction on Cox Automotive’s Xtime and Dealertrack products.
  • Deliver engaging product training that drives product adoption and enhances dealership operations.
  • Deliver on-site and virtual training to drive product adoption and business impact.
  • Collaborate with dealership leaders to develop tailored training plans, assess software/hardware readiness and recommend solutions.
  • Build and maintain deep product knowledge and stay current on automotive trends to deliver high-impact, relevant training and consulting.
  • Troubleshoot client challenges and provide hands-on support to ensure smooth product implementation.
  • Foster strong business relationships through effective communication of training progress, project status and client needs.
  • Participate in product enhancement reviews, group projects, stretch assignments and internal training initiatives.
  • Partner with your manager and mentors to grow through regular feedback and coaching.

Travel:

  • This is a 100% nationwide travel role, with the benefit of a 4-day work week.

Who You Are You’re a driven, high-energy professional who loves to travel. Your enthusiasm is contagious, and you’re skilled at inspiring others. Here’s what sets you apart: Minimum:

  • A bachelor’s degree with 2 years of automotive or dealership experience; a master’s degree with up to 2 years of related experience; or 6 years of related automotive or dealership experience with no degree.
  • At least one year of experience with Fixed Ops (Parts/Service) required.
  • Outstanding verbal, written and presentation skills with the ability to effectively articulate and communicate in a way that retains trainee engagement.
  • Strong emotional intelligence and a people-first mindset.
  • A proactive mindset with a willingness to learn and take on stretch opportunities.
  • Comfort with extensive weekly and overnight travel.
  • Demonstrated ability to work in a team-oriented, collaborative environment.
  • The ability to multitask and prioritize effectively.
  • A str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ications.

Preferred:

  • Fixed Ops Advisor/Manager experience.
  • Experience and familiarity with Salesforce and/or Cox Automotive products.
  • Experience leading trainings or working directly with clients.
